How much do payroll project man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 12, 2026, the average yearly pay for payroll project manager in the United States is $89,396.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$71,000.00 and $104,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a payroll project manager?

To thrive as a Payroll Project Manager, you need expertise in payroll processes, project management methodologies, and a solid understanding of compliance regulations, often supported by a degree in business or finance. Familiarity with payroll software systems (such as ADP or SAP), project management tools, and certifications like PMP or CPP are typically required. Strong organizational, leadership, and communication skills help in managing cross-functional teams and ensuring smooth project delivery. These skills and qualifications are crucial to ensure accurate payroll execution, compliance with legal standards, and successful project implementation within deadlines.

What are some common challenges faced by payroll project managers during system implementations?

Payroll Project Managers often encounter challenges such as aligning project timelines with payroll cycles, ensuring data integrity during migration, and managing compliance with local and international regulations. Coordinating across multiple departments, such as HR, IT, and finance, can also present difficulties due to varying priorities and workflows. Effective communication, strong organizational skills, and a clear understanding of both technical and payroll-specific requirements are essential to navigating these challenges successfully.

What does a payroll project manager do?

A payroll project manager oversees the planning, implementation, and management of payroll systems and processes within an organization. They coordinate with HR, finance, and IT teams to ensure accurate and timely payroll delivery, often using project management tools and compliance standards. Their role includes managing deadlines, resolving payroll issues, and ensuring adherence to relevant regulations.

Job Duties:

  • Payroll Processing - Verify office, branch, and factory weekly timesheets. Input payroll data such as changes in hours, direct deposit information, garnishments, and deductions such as safety, medical, dental, 401k etc. and review for accuracy.  Post paid leave hours in the human resources information system (HRIS).   Create payment for employees on short-term disability.  Confirm payroll bi-weekly.  Transmit direct deposit for the company, print and distribute ( bi-weekly payroll and reports.  Complete monthly salesperson commission statements, distribute to the appropriate personnel and make corresponding adjustments to payroll.  Collaborate with the HRIS Administrator/Payroll Administrator, managers/supervisors, and other personnel to answer questions and solve problems regarding payroll.
  • Payroll Project Responsibilities - Review all W-2 statements and issues that affect the statements throughout the year.  Process W-2 related reports and review as needed.  Provide garnishment reports to Accounts Payable for payment.  Reconcile the garnishment account.  Complete General Ledger (G/L) and tax balance adjustments as needed.  Reconcile and pay child support payments on-line.  Reconcile 401k figures sent to third party.  Prepare payroll tables in HRIS for the up-coming year.  Assist in the review of payroll-related issues that affect the bank reconciliation on a monthly basis.  Process special payments throughout the year, Miscellaneous Income Compensation (monthly), 25 Year Club, and other annual awards. Reconcile all fiscal payroll withholding taxes for the auditors.  Perform tasks as needed related to new HR/Payroll projects such as tax updates.
  • Support - Provide support for the bi-weekly payroll process to HR and Benefits.  Complete research as requested.  Respond to inquiries from employees and supervisors regarding deductions, payments, allowances or discrepancies in pay.  Maintain employee confidence and protect operations by keeping information confidential.  Answer questions.
